Why this unit
Ordinary hydronic heat pumps top out around 130°F, which is not hot enough for the baseboard radiators older houses were designed around. The 504W11 uses OptiHeat vapor-injection technology to push leaving water to 145°F, so it can replace a boiler without touching the radiators.
Available in 4 and 5 ton sizes, backed by the same warranties as the rest of the WaterFurnace line.
Best for: Houses with baseboard radiators or older radiant systems on a boiler.
- Up to 145°F leaving water via OptiHeat vapor injection
- Drop-in boiler replacement for baseboard and radiant systems
- 4 and 5 ton capacities
